Myron Mixon was born on May 31, 1962. He is a famous American chef and a top competitor in the world of barbecue. He has won the World Championship five times. Myron Mixon also appeared as a judge on the TV show BBQ Pitmasters. People call him "the winningest man in barbecue" because he has won so many awards.

Myron Mixon's Barbecue Journey
Starting in Competitive BBQ
Myron Mixon began competing in barbecue in 1996. His first competition was in Atlanta, Georgia. He won first place for cooking a whole hog. He also got third place for his pork shoulder. Myron started competing to help promote his family's barbecue sauce. His parents, Gaye and Jack, created the sauce. His father taught him how to barbecue. Myron named his barbecue company "Jack's Old South" after his dad.
Winning Many Championships
Myron Mixon has won more than 180 major barbecue championships. He has also collected over 1,700 barbecue trophies. He won the Grand Champion title at the Memphis in May World Championship five times. These wins were in 2001, 2004, 2007, 2016, and 2021. He has also won the Big Pig Jig Grand Champion title many times. His most recent win there was in 2012, which was his third win in a row.
Myron Mixon has not yet won the Jack Daniel's BBQ World Invitational. He says this is the most important competition in barbecue. In 2004, he came in second place, missing first by only 0.1 points. However, he has won the whole hog competition there three times. His many wins have earned him the nickname "the winningest man in barbecue."
Myron Mixon on TV
Myron Mixon first appeared on the TV show BBQ Pitmasters on the TLC channel. In the first season, he was a contestant. The show followed barbecue chefs to different competitions. For the second season, the show changed. It became a competition game show. Myron Mixon became one of the three judges. He judged alongside chefs Art Smith and Warren Sapp.
The third season of BBQ Pitmasters moved to the Destination America TV channel. Myron Mixon was the only judge who stayed on the show. He was joined by other barbecue chefs, Aaron Franklin and Tuffy Stone.
Writing Cookbooks and Other Appearances
In 2010, Myron Mixon signed a deal to write cookbooks. His first book, Smokin' with Myron Mixon, was published in 2011. Famous chef Paula Deen wrote the introduction for it. In May 2012, he appeared on NBC's The Today Show. He had a barbecue cook-off against Pat Martin. Myron cooked a brisket recipe.
Becoming a Mayor
Myron Mixon was elected mayor of his hometown, Unadilla, Georgia. He started his four-year term as mayor in January 2016.
Myron Mixon's Books
- Smokin' with Myron Mixon (2011)
- Everyday Barbecue: At Home with America's Favorite Pitmaster (2013)
- Myron Mixon's BBQ Rules (2016)
Myron Mixon's Restaurants
In January 2017, Myron Mixon opened a restaurant. It was called Myron Mixon’s Pitmaster BBQ. He opened it with his business partners Joe Corey and Bill McFadden. The restaurant was in Alexandria, Virginia, but it is now closed. It served some of Myron’s famous dishes. These included Jack's Peach BBQ Baked Beans and Baby Back Mac and Cheese. It also had Dry Rubbed Wings and other favorites.
